/README.md:
--------------------------------------------------------------------------------
1 | # CameraX Sample
2 |
3 | A sample application that uses the new Jetpack CameraX support library. The app takes input for a phrase from the user, and then uses CameraX and MLKit Text Recognition to preview the camera feed, analyze the image buffer to search for the phrase, and capture the image once the phrase has been detected.
4 |
5 | To build this locally, you must [create a Firebase project and add the google-services.json](https://firebase.google.com/docs/android/setup), then build.
6 |

/app/src/main/java/com/captechventures/cameraxsample/AutoFitPreviewBuilder.kt:
--------------------------------------------------------------------------------
1 | /*
2 | * Copyright 2019 Google LLC
3 | *
4 | * Licensed under the Apache License, Version 2.0 (the "License");
5 | * you may not use this file except in compliance with the License.
6 | * You may obtain a copy of the License at
7 | *
8 | * https://www.apache.org/licenses/LICENSE-2.0
9 | *
10 | * Unless required by applicable law or agreed to in writing, software
11 | * distributed under the License is distributed on an "AS IS" BASIS,
12 | *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
13 | * See the License for the specific language governing permissions and
14 | * limitations under the License.
15 | */
16 |
17 | package com.captechventures.cameraxsample
18 |
19 | import android.content.Context
20 | import android.graphics.Matrix
21 | import android.hardware.display.DisplayManager
22 | import android.util.Log
23 | import android.util.Size
24 | import android.view.*
25 | import androidx.camera.core.Preview
26 | import androidx.camera.core.PreviewConfig
27 | import java.lang.ref.WeakReference
28 | import java.util.*
29 |
30 | /**
31 | * Builder for [Preview] that takes in a [WeakReference] of the view finder and
32 | * [PreviewConfig], then instantiates a [Preview] which automatically
33 | * resizes and rotates reacting to config changes.
34 | *
35 | *
36 | * Taken from Google's CameraXBasic repo https://github.com/android/camera/tree/master/CameraXBasic
37 | */
38 | class AutoFitPreviewBuilder private constructor(config: PreviewConfig,
39 | viewFinderRef: WeakReference) {
40 | /** Public instance of preview use-case which can be used by consumers of this adapter */
41 | val useCase: Preview
42 |
43 | /** Internal variable used to keep track of the use-case's output rotation */
44 | private var bufferRotation: Int = 0
45 | /** Internal variable used to keep track of the view's rotation */
46 | private var viewFinderRotation: Int? = null
47 | /** Internal variable used to keep track of the use-case's output dimension */
48 | private var bufferDimens: Size = Size(0, 0)
49 | /** Internal variable used to keep track of the view's dimension */
50 | private var viewFinderDimens: Size = Size(0, 0)
51 | /** Internal variable used to keep track of the view's display */
52 | private var viewFinderDisplay: Int = -1
53 |
54 | private lateinit var displayManager: DisplayManager
55 | /** We need a display listener for 180 degree device orientation changes */
56 | private val displayListener = object : DisplayManager.DisplayListener {
57 | override fun onDisplayAdded(displayId: Int) = Unit
58 | override fun onDisplayRemoved(displayId: Int) = Unit
59 | override fun onDisplayChanged(displayId: Int) {
60 | val viewFinder = viewFinderRef.get() ?: return
61 | if (displayId != viewFinderDisplay) {
62 | val display = displayManager.getDisplay(displayId)
63 | val rotation = getDisplaySurfaceRotation(display)
64 | updateTransform(viewFinder, rotation, bufferDimens, viewFinderDimens)
65 | }
66 | }
67 | }
68 |
69 | init {
70 | // Make sure that the view finder reference is valid
71 | val viewFinder = viewFinderRef.get() ?: throw IllegalArgumentException(
72 | "Invalid reference to view finder used")
73 |
74 | // Initialize the display and rotation from texture view information
75 | viewFinderDisplay = viewFinder.display.displayId
76 | viewFinderRotation = getDisplaySurfaceRotation(viewFinder.display) ?: 0
77 |
78 | // Initialize public use-case with the given config
79 | useCase = Preview(config)
80 |
81 | // Every time the view finder is updated, recompute layout
82 | useCase.onPreviewOutputUpdateListener = Preview.OnPreviewOutputUpdateListener {
83 | val finder =
84 | viewFinderRef.get() ?: return@OnPreviewOutputUpdateListener
85 |
86 | // To update the SurfaceTexture, we have to remove it and re-add it
87 | val parent = finder.parent as ViewGroup
88 | parent.removeView(finder)
89 | parent.addView(finder, 0)
90 | finder.surfaceTexture = it.surfaceTexture
91 | bufferRotation = it.rotationDegrees
92 | val rotation = getDisplaySurfaceRotation(viewFinder.display)
93 | updateTransform(viewFinder, rotation, it.textureSize, viewFinderDimens)
94 | }
95 |
96 | // Every time the provided texture view changes, recompute layout
97 | viewFinder.addOnLayoutChangeListener { view, left, top, right, bottom, _, _, _, _ ->
98 | val finder = view as TextureView
99 | val newViewFinderDimens = Size(right - left, bottom - top)
100 | val rotation = getDisplaySurfaceRotation(finder.display)
101 | updateTransform(finder, rotation, bufferDimens, newViewFinderDimens)
102 | }
103 |
104 | // Every time the orientation of device changes, recompute layout
105 | displayManager = viewFinder.context
106 | .getSystemService(Context.DISPLAY_SERVICE) as DisplayManager
107 | displayManager.registerDisplayListener(displayListener, null)
108 |
109 | // // Remove the display listeners when the view is detached to avoid
110 | // // holding a reference to the View outside of a Fragment.
111 | // // NOTE: Even though using a weak reference should take care of this,
112 | // // we still try to avoid unnecessary calls to the listener this way.
113 | viewFinder.addOnAttachStateChangeListener(object : View.OnAttachStateChangeListener {
114 | override fun onViewAttachedToWindow(view: View?) = Unit
115 | override fun onViewDetachedFromWindow(view: View?) {
116 | displayManager.unregisterDisplayListener(displayListener)
117 | }
118 |
119 | })
120 | }
121 |
122 | private fun updateTransform(viewFinder: TextureView) {
123 | val matrix = Matrix()
124 |
125 | // Compute the center of the view finder
126 | val centerX = viewFinder.width / 2f
127 | val centerY = viewFinder.height / 2f
128 |
129 | // Correct preview output to account for display rotation
130 | val rotationDegrees = getDisplaySurfaceRotation(viewFinder.display) ?: 0
131 | matrix.postRotate(-rotationDegrees.toFloat(), centerX, centerY)
132 |
133 | // Finally, apply transformations to our TextureView
134 | viewFinder.setTransform(matrix)
135 | }
136 |
137 | /** Helper function that fits a camera preview into the given [TextureView] */
138 | private fun updateTransform(textureView: TextureView?, rotation: Int?, newBufferDimens: Size,
139 | newViewFinderDimens: Size) {
140 | // This should happen anyway, but now the linter knows
141 | Log.d("DEBUG_TAG", "checking textureview: $textureView")
142 | val view = textureView ?: return
143 |
144 | if (rotation == viewFinderRotation &&
145 | Objects.equals(newBufferDimens, bufferDimens) &&
146 | Objects.equals(newViewFinderDimens, viewFinderDimens)) {
147 | // Nothing has changed, no need to transform output again
148 | Log.d("DEBUG_TAG", "nothing changed?")
149 | return
150 | }
151 |
152 | if (rotation == null) {
153 | // Invalid rotation - wait for valid inputs before setting matrix
154 | Log.d("DEBUG_TAG", "wat")
155 | return
156 | } else {
157 | // Update internal field with new inputs
158 | viewFinderRotation = rotation
159 | }
160 |
161 | if (newBufferDimens.width == 0 || newBufferDimens.height == 0) {
162 | // Invalid buffer dimens - wait for valid inputs before setting matrix
163 | Log.d("DEBUG_TAG", "invalid buffer dimens?")
164 | return
165 | } else {
166 | // Update internal field with new inputs
167 | bufferDimens = newBufferDimens
168 | }
169 |
170 | if (newViewFinderDimens.width == 0 || newViewFinderDimens.height == 0) {
171 | Log.d("DEBUG_TAG", "invalid view finder dimens?")
172 | // Invalid view finder dimens - wait for valid inputs before setting matrix
173 | return
174 | } else {
175 | // Update internal field with new inputs
176 | viewFinderDimens = newViewFinderDimens
177 | }
178 |
179 | val matrix = Matrix()
180 |
181 | // Compute the center of the view finder
182 | val centerX = viewFinderDimens.width / 2f
183 | val centerY = viewFinderDimens.height / 2f
184 |
185 | // Correct preview output to account for display rotation
186 | matrix.postRotate(-viewFinderRotation!!.toFloat(), centerX, centerY)
187 |
188 | // Buffers are rotated relative to the device's 'natural' orientation: swap width and height
189 | val bufferRatio = bufferDimens.height / bufferDimens.width.toFloat()
190 |
191 | val scaledWidth: Int
192 | val scaledHeight: Int
193 | // Match longest sides together -- i.e. apply center-crop transformation
194 | if (viewFinderDimens.width > viewFinderDimens.height) {
195 | scaledHeight = viewFinderDimens.width
196 | scaledWidth = Math.round(viewFinderDimens.width * bufferRatio)
197 | } else {
198 | scaledHeight = viewFinderDimens.height
199 | scaledWidth = Math.round(viewFinderDimens.height * bufferRatio)
200 | }
201 |
202 | // Compute the relative scale value
203 | val xScale = scaledWidth / viewFinderDimens.width.toFloat()
204 | val yScale = scaledHeight / viewFinderDimens.height.toFloat()
205 |
206 | // Scale input buffers to fill the view finder
207 | matrix.preScale(xScale, yScale, centerX, centerY)
208 | Log.d("DEBUG_TAG", "setting transform")
209 | // Finally, apply transformations to our TextureView
210 | view.setTransform(matrix)
211 | }
212 |
213 | companion object {
214 | /** Helper function that gets the rotation of a [Display] in degrees */
215 | fun getDisplaySurfaceRotation(display: Display?) = when(display?.rotation) {
216 | Surface.ROTATION_0 -> 0
217 | Surface.ROTATION_90 -> 90
218 | Surface.ROTATION_180 -> 180
219 | Surface.ROTATION_270 -> 270
220 | else -> null
221 | }
222 |
223 | /**
224 | * Main entrypoint for users of this class: instantiates the adapter and returns an instance
225 | * of [Preview] which automatically adjusts in size and rotation to compensate for
226 | * config changes.
227 | */
228 | fun build(config: PreviewConfig, viewFinder: TextureView) =
229 | AutoFitPreviewBuilder(config, WeakReference(viewFinder)).useCase
230 | }
231 | }

/app/src/main/java/com/captechventures/cameraxsample/CameraFragment.kt:
--------------------------------------------------------------------------------
1 | package com.captechventures.cameraxsample
2 |
3 | import android.Manifest
4 | import android.content.pm.PackageManager
5 | import android.os.Bundle
6 | import android.os.Handler
7 | import android.os.HandlerThread
8 | import android.util.*
9 | import android.view.LayoutInflater
10 | import android.view.View
11 | import android.view.ViewGroup
12 | import android.widget.Toast
13 | import androidx.camera.core.*
14 | import androidx.core.content.ContextCompat
15 | import androidx.fragment.app.Fragment
16 | import androidx.fragment.app.transaction
17 | import com.google.firebase.ml.vision.FirebaseVision
18 | import com.google.firebase.ml.vision.common.FirebaseVisionImage
19 | import com.google.firebase.ml.vision.common.FirebaseVisionImageMetadata
20 | import com.google.firebase.ml.vision.text.FirebaseVisionText
21 | import kotlinx.android.synthetic.main.fragment_camera.*
22 | import java.io.File
23 | import java.util.concurrent.TimeUnit
24 |
25 | const val TAG = "CameraXSample"
26 |
27 | class CameraFragment : Fragment() {
28 |
29 | private var imageCapture: ImageCapture? = null
30 |
31 | private val cameraPermissionGranted
32 | get() = ContextCompat.checkSelfPermission(
33 | requireContext(), Manifest.permission.CAMERA
34 | ) == PackageManager.PERMISSION_GRANTED
35 |
36 | private var phrase = ""
37 |
38 |
39 | // listener for after an image is captured
40 | private val imageCaptureListener = object : ImageCapture.OnImageSavedListener {
41 | override fun onError(error: ImageCapture.UseCaseError, message: String, exc: Throwable?) {
42 | Log.e(TAG, "Photo capture failed: $message", exc)
43 | }
44 |
45 | override fun onImageSaved(photoFile: File) {
46 | Log.d(TAG, "Photo capture succeeded: ${photoFile.absolutePath}")
47 | requireFragmentManager().transaction {
48 | replace(R.id.fragmentContainer, PhotoFragment.newInstance(photoFile.absolutePath))
49 | addToBackStack(null)
50 | }
51 | }
52 | }
53 |
54 | override fun onCreate(savedInstanceState: Bundle?) {
55 | super.onCreate(savedInstanceState)
56 |
57 | phrase = requireArguments().getString(PHRASE_ARG, "")
58 | }
59 |
60 | override fun onCreateView(inflater: LayoutInflater, container: ViewGroup?, savedInstanceState: Bundle?): View? {
61 | return inflater.inflate(R.layout.fragment_camera, container, false)
62 | }
63 |
64 | override fun onViewCreated(view: View, savedInstanceState: Bundle?) {
65 | super.onViewCreated(view, savedInstanceState)
66 |
67 | if (cameraPermissionGranted) {
68 | surfacePreview.post { startCamera() }
69 | } else {
70 | requestPermissions(arrayOf(Manifest.permission.CAMERA), PERMISSION_CODE)
71 | }
72 |
73 | Toast.makeText(requireContext(), "Point camera at text containing the phrase: $phrase", Toast.LENGTH_LONG)
74 | .show()
75 | }
76 |
77 | override fun onRequestPermissionsResult(requestCode: Int, permissions: Array, grantResults: IntArray) {
78 | super.onRequestPermissionsResult(requestCode, permissions, grantResults)
79 | if (requestCode == PERMISSION_CODE) {
80 | if (cameraPermissionGranted) {
81 | // permission granted start camera
82 | surfacePreview.post { startCamera() }
83 | } else {
84 | Toast.makeText(requireContext(), "Permission denied, closing.", Toast.LENGTH_LONG).show()
85 | requireActivity().finish()
86 | }
87 | }
88 | }
89 |
90 | override fun onDestroyView() {
91 | super.onDestroyView()
92 | CameraX.unbindAll()
93 | }
94 |
95 | private fun startCamera() {
96 | // unbind anything that still might be open
97 | CameraX.unbindAll()
98 |
99 | val metrics = DisplayMetrics().also { surfacePreview.display.getRealMetrics(it) }
100 | val screenSize = Size(metrics.widthPixels, metrics.heightPixels)
101 | val screenAspectRatio = Rational(metrics.widthPixels, metrics.heightPixels)
102 |
103 | val previewConfig = PreviewConfig.Builder()
104 | .setLensFacing(CameraX.LensFacing.BACK)
105 | .setTargetAspectRatio(screenAspectRatio)
106 | .setTargetResolution(screenSize)
107 | .build()
108 |
109 | // Build the viewfinder use case
110 | val preview = AutoFitPreviewBuilder.build(previewConfig, surfacePreview)
111 |
112 | val analyzerConfig = ImageAnalysisConfig.Builder().apply {
113 | setLensFacing(CameraX.LensFacing.BACK)
114 | val analyzerThread = HandlerThread("OCR").apply { start() }
115 | setCallbackHandler(Handler(analyzerThread.looper))
116 | setImageReaderMode(ImageAnalysis.ImageReaderMode.ACQUIRE_LATEST_IMAGE)
117 | setTargetResolution(Size(1280, 720))
118 | }.build()
119 |
120 | val captureConfig = ImageCaptureConfig.Builder()
121 | .setLensFacing(CameraX.LensFacing.BACK)
122 | .setCaptureMode(ImageCapture.CaptureMode.MIN_LATENCY)
123 | .setTargetRotation(surfacePreview.display.rotation)
124 | .setTargetAspectRatio(screenAspectRatio)
125 | .build()
126 |
127 | imageCapture = ImageCapture(captureConfig)
128 |
129 |
130 | val imageAnalysis = ImageAnalysis(analyzerConfig)
131 | imageAnalysis.analyzer = TextAnalyzer(phrase) {
132 | val outputDirectory: File = requireContext().filesDir
133 | val photoFile = File(outputDirectory, "${System.currentTimeMillis()}.jpg")
134 | imageCapture?.takePicture(photoFile, imageCaptureListener, ImageCapture.Metadata())
135 |
136 | }
137 |
138 | CameraX.bindToLifecycle(this, preview, imageAnalysis, imageCapture)
139 | }
140 |
141 |
142 | companion object {
143 |
144 | private const val PERMISSION_CODE = 15
145 | private const val PHRASE_ARG = "phrase_arg"
146 |
147 | @JvmStatic
148 | fun newInstance(phrase: String): CameraFragment {
149 | return CameraFragment().apply {
150 | arguments = Bundle().apply { putString(PHRASE_ARG, phrase) }
151 | }
152 | }
153 |
154 | }
155 | }
156 |
157 | class TextAnalyzer(
158 | private val identifier: String,
159 | private val identifierDetectedCallback: () -> Unit
160 | ) : ImageAnalysis.Analyzer {
161 |
162 | companion object {
163 | private val ORIENTATIONS = SparseIntArray()
164 |
165 | init {
166 | ORIENTATIONS.append(0, FirebaseVisionImageMetadata.ROTATION_0)
167 | ORIENTATIONS.append(90, FirebaseVisionImageMetadata.ROTATION_90)
168 | ORIENTATIONS.append(180, FirebaseVisionImageMetadata.ROTATION_180)
169 | ORIENTATIONS.append(270, FirebaseVisionImageMetadata.ROTATION_270)
170 | }
171 | }
172 |
173 | private var lastAnalyzedTimestamp = 0L
174 |
175 |
176 | private fun getOrientationFromRotation(rotationDegrees: Int): Int {
177 | return when (rotationDegrees) {
178 | 0 -> FirebaseVisionImageMetadata.ROTATION_0
179 | 90 -> FirebaseVisionImageMetadata.ROTATION_90
180 | 180 -> FirebaseVisionImageMetadata.ROTATION_180
181 | 270 -> FirebaseVisionImageMetadata.ROTATION_270
182 | else -> FirebaseVisionImageMetadata.ROTATION_90
183 | }
184 | }
185 |
186 | override fun analyze(image: ImageProxy?, rotationDegrees: Int) {
187 | if (image?.image == null || image.image == null) return
188 |
189 | val timestamp = System.currentTimeMillis()
190 | // only run once per second
191 | if (timestamp - lastAnalyzedTimestamp >= TimeUnit.SECONDS.toMillis(1)) {
192 | val visionImage = FirebaseVisionImage.fromMediaImage(
193 | image.image!!,
194 | getOrientationFromRotation(rotationDegrees)
195 | )
196 |
197 | val detector = FirebaseVision.getInstance()
198 | .onDeviceTextRecognizer
199 |
200 | detector.processImage(visionImage)
201 | .addOnSuccessListener { result: FirebaseVisionText ->
202 | // remove the new lines and join to a single string,
203 | // then search for our identifier
204 | val textToSearch = result.text.split("\n").joinToString(" ")
205 | if (textToSearch.contains(identifier, true)) {
206 | identifierDetectedCallback()
207 | }
208 | }
209 | .addOnFailureListener {
210 | Log.e(TAG, "Error processing image", it)
211 | }
212 | lastAnalyzedTimestamp = timestamp
213 | }
214 | }
215 |
216 | }
